Names based on places are hugely popular these days and for good reason.
Whether it is a city you’ve always wanted to visit, a country of your own origin, or a place you visited and left with unforgettable moments, name-giving your little one after a place adds narrative to his personality.
Geographical baby names are filled with fantasy and adventure, the image of a child doomed to explore and conquer the world.
Names like Austin are a homage to the culture of Texas and also sleek and contemporary. Or Cairo, a name with a mystery and a past wrapped around its vowels. And then there’s Denver — the rugged and robust name, for outdoors-y parents.
Some are grand and flashy, like Rio or London, some are quaint and ancient, such as Adrian or Everest.
